Oden Proposes Building Renewal for Roland Bowers Site

Charles Oden, owner of Peat's Melody shop, asks the city council to extend a renewal agreement if he purchases the Roland Bowers building, which also houses Bowers Barbershop and the Melody shop’s bakery. The council indicated it would apply the same terms to the purchase.

Blood donation drive nets 47 pints as donors assist

Donors at a Bloodmobile on August 2 contributed 47 pints with 60 attending and 13 declined. Harold Shephard will have open heart surgery in Portland within a month, supported by 24 pints. Curtis Beckham leads with Har old Walton assisting. Rainbow Girls Becky Noyes organized calls. Mrs Bert Gaenor chaired the contest. Jim King accepts five day visit to the Naval Academy.

Recall motion stalls as petition drive pegs targets

J. J Bob Geaney, chair of the county board, slows recall effort as Burns heads the committee to remove him notes the pace is not rapid. The committee has about 1,600 of an expected 4,000 signatures with 9 days left from July 9 to file for certification.
